mirror of https://github.com/kurisufriend/shttpile
You can not select more than 25 topics
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
16 lines
396 B
16 lines
396 B
import socket
|
|
import response
|
|
import sys
|
|
import os
|
|
s = socket.socket(socket.AF_INET, socket.SOCK_STREAM)
|
|
s.bind(("0.0.0.0", 1337))
|
|
s.listen()
|
|
while True:
|
|
c, c_add = s.accept()
|
|
print(c_add)
|
|
raw_req = c.recv(2048).decode("ascii")
|
|
print(raw_req)
|
|
r = response.request.build_response(response.request.parse(raw_req))
|
|
c.sendall(r.text().encode("ascii"))
|
|
c.close()
|
|
s.close()
|
|
|